bbjay Posted - 12/02/2012 : 22:45:43
Hi i finally got my mbk this morning after waiting 3 weeks Hooray :) now i have a question.. my corn snake and kingsnake are both in rubs and they are practiclly next to each other and wanted to know if this will be a problem with kings being cannabalistic and been able to smell my corn snake ? Will either if them get stressed as they can slightly see into eachothers rub ? Left is mbk 9l rub and right is corn 12l rub mbk is unknown sex and 2month old and corn female and is 6month old


thankyou

Emmy1 Posted - 13/02/2012 : 20:58:43
My King is also kept next to my other snake and lizards without issue.
Mort13 Posted - 13/02/2012 : 20:08:22
My MBK is in the middle viv of a 3 viv stack with corns above and below and housed next to the rack,I've had no issues either.
Oh,and congrats on the new addition.
Sta~ple Posted - 13/02/2012 : 10:18:16
My mbk is in a stack of corns and is fine too :-D
Mamma Posted - 13/02/2012 : 00:13:35
there wont be a problem keeping them near I have an MBK who's in a viv stack with 2 corns (3 eventually) and a western hognose. It doesn't faze her though xx
bbjay Posted - 12/02/2012 : 23:57:04
Ok thanks gmac will sort out quarantine helpfull as always :)
gmac Posted - 12/02/2012 : 23:20:49
would have had your MBK in quarantine for a few months away from your corn. But no there shouldnt be any issues with them that close
